About this activity

The 2 hours tour of the island with a typical boat and local multilingual speaking sailor will take you to visit the famous blu grotto and the lesser known sea grottoes. You will have time to swim and if you prefer you can have a picnic on board at your choice.

Itinerary

  1. 1
    Blue Grotto

    15 min - one of the most evocative and famous place in the world thanks to the splendid game of light and the legends it hides (ticket not included);

  2. 2
    Green Grotta

    10 min - You can swim or climb the cliffs in the Green Grotto, which looks like an enormous liquid emerald.

  3. 3
    Red Grotta

    10 min - takes his coulour thanks to seaweed

  4. 4
    Natural Arch

    10 min - on the east coast of the island of Capri. Dating from the Paleolithic age, it is the remains of a collapsed grotto.

  5. 5
    I Faraglioni

    15 min - One of the first images to come to mind will, no doubt, be that of the Faraglioni: the three spurs of rock which rise up out of the sea, within meters of the island's Southern coast

We toured all around the island starting first ,almost immediately since it's close, with the Blue Grotto which I'll discuss in depth as it's the most popular attraction. I read a lot of reviews across the internet, and even here, saying you may end up turning away from the Grotto due to long wait times. We didn't have this problem at all. It was the last week of October, which is supposed to be the very last week of the tourist season, so maybe we were on the tail end of it? It still seemed pretty crowded everywhere we went in Italy on this trip so I don't know if that's the case. Or it could just be that it was the fact we pulled up in a private boat with only two of us? There were a number of other boats already there (some like ours and some much bigger with many people) and plenty of people waiting on line on the stairs coming via the land route as well. Maybe Cheerio just knew the guy who immediately came right to our boat when we got there to take us into the Grotto haha. Either way, it all worked out perfectly for us, and my wife even had time to change in the cabin on the boat beforehand. I'm pretty sure you can skip this whole part if you really wanted to though. The Grotto costs €14 and the row boat skippers will expect and even ask for a tip on top of that. I'd say to just tip the row boat skipper at the end without issue. It's the very rare occasion you'll ever tip in Italy, so really not much to complain about. You need to lay fully down flat on your back in the row boat and the skipper has to pull the boat in via a chain, and the boat sort of submerges very slightly, but no you don't get wet. You're in the grotto for only some minutes, and there are other boats in there with yours. The skippers all sing inside with a sort of haunting echoing vibe, in part, but I also found it a bit funny and just a lot of fun since I already knew to expect that. Our row boat skipper took our picture inside as well. Now I know what you're thinking, yes maybe this whole Blue Grotto thing might seem touristy to some, but really, when are you going to do something like this again? Just go all out and enjoy it. We did and it was a beautiful and fun time. Be aware that the sun is the reason the grotto is blue, so keep that in mind. If it's cloudy, you might not see the effect I've heard.
